The Broadway show "Movin' Out" was based on songs written by the songwriter named Billy Joel.
The musical features many of his songs, among which is of course the eponymous song Movin' Out (Anthony's Song), released in 1977 on his album The Stranger. It was an immediate hit, and it influenced many other artistic performances as well.
